Chistmas lunch menu - wdyt?

We're having a total of 8 people for Christmas bunch/lunch - here's my menu plan, what do you think? DH's family is Italian, hence having ravs with the meal since that is what "makes" it Christmas for him.  

App - Antipasto plate with meats, cheeses, olives, peppers, really yummy bread, and mushroom turnovers (hot)

Main meal - ham, ravioli, mashed sweet potato,  green veg, bread, cranberry sauce, and maybe a orzo and rice salad

Dessert - TBD (any suggestions?), plus cookies and candy out 

I haven't shopped yet so pretty much anything can be changed except the antipasto and the ravs (DH's requests). I could do a roast or leg of lamb, but I thought the ham would go home better with people for leftovers plus it's less work for me.
